NYTAG INC New York Transgender Advocacy Group, founded in 2015, is a community nonprofit in the Civil Rights & Advocacy sector that reported $1.1M in total revenue in fiscal year 2025. Revenue surged 108%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$181K, a strong 17% operating margin.

Mission

NYTAG ADVOCATES FOR A MORE INCLUSIVE GENDER-BASED POLICIES THAT BENEFIT TRANSGENDER AND GENDER NON-CONFORMING/NON-BINARY (TGNCNB) INDIVIDUALS THROUGH BUILDING COMMUNITY LEADERS,EDUCATING PRACTITIONERS, AND INFLUENCING POLICY MAKERS.
